Replacing an evaporative emission control (EVAP) canister is not a one-size-fits-all job. While the charcoal canister itself does the same job on every car storing fuel vapors to keep them out of the atmosphere the physical layout changes completely from one automaker to the next. This is why following a vehicle-specific EVAP canister replacement procedure matters. If you rely on a generic tutorial, you might end up dropping the wrong heat shield, snapping a fragile plastic vent line, or struggling with a mounting bracket that requires a special socket.

Where is the EVAP canister located on my vehicle?

On older vehicles or specific compact cars, you might find the charcoal canister right in the engine bay. However, most modern cars, trucks, and SUVs mount it underneath the vehicle, usually near the rear axle or directly beside the fuel tank. You will need to safely lift and support the rear of the vehicle using jack stands. Never rely solely on a hydraulic jack when working under the car, as the suspension needs to hang freely to access the rear undercarriage components.

How do I know if the canister actually needs replacing?

Before tearing into the undercarriage, make sure the canister is actually the culprit. A glowing check engine light with OBD2 codes like P0440, P0446, or P0455 points to an EVAP leak or flow issue. But the canister itself rarely fails unless it gets saturated with liquid fuel or physically cracks from road debris. Often, the real problem is a stuck purge valve under the hood or a corroded vent solenoid attached to the canister. If you smell raw gas near the rear of the car, notice the canister is heavy and sloshing with liquid, or see visible cracks in the plastic housing, it is time for a new unit.

What are the exact steps to swap the canister?

The physical swap involves disconnecting the electrical harness, removing the vapor lines, and unbolting the bracket. When sourcing parts, be careful with cheap replacements, as you might run into aftermarket fitment issues where the bracket holes do not line up with your factory mounting points. Always verify the part number matches your exact make, model, and engine size.

  1. Disconnect the negative battery terminal to reset the engine computer and prevent electrical shorts.
  2. Locate the canister and take a clear photo of the hose routing and electrical connectors before touching anything.
  3. Press the release tabs on the quick-connect fittings to detach the vapor lines. If they are stuck, use a specialized fuel line disconnect tool rather than prying with a flathead screwdriver, which will crack the plastic collar.
  4. Unplug the electrical connector for the vent valve. Press the locking tab down firmly before pulling.
  5. Remove the mounting bolts and lower the old assembly.
  6. Transfer any necessary metal brackets, heat shields, or fuel tank pressure sensors to the new canister.
  7. Reinstall in reverse order, making sure the quick-connect lines click firmly into place.

Why is my gas pump clicking off after the replacement?

A very common mistake during reassembly is kinking the vent hose or pushing a quick-connect fitting in too far, which restricts airflow. If you go to the gas station and the pump keeps shutting off every few seconds, the tank cannot vent properly. How do I clear the codes and test the repair?

Simply erasing the OBD2 codes with a scanner does not mean the repair was successful. The EVAP monitor is a non-continuous monitor, meaning the car's computer needs specific driving conditions to test the system for leaks. You will need to complete a drive cycle. This usually involves driving at a steady highway speed for about 15 minutes, then doing some stop-and-go city driving with the fuel tank between a quarter and three-quarters full. If the check engine light stays off after a few days of normal driving, your repair held up.

Pre-Drive Final Inspection Checklist

  • Verify all quick-connect fittings are fully seated by giving each hose a gentle tug.
  • Ensure the electrical connector clicks and the plastic locking tab is fully engaged.
  • Check that no vapor hoses are resting against the exhaust system, which will quickly melt the plastic lines.
  • Confirm all mounting bolts are torqued to spec so the canister does not rattle against the frame over bumps.
  • Keep your OBD2 scanner handy to monitor the EVAP monitor status over the next week of driving.
